Output 29f17d86f738fd720fa68d7e0403136d695d122cc47c4ef8c8698abce6230858:15

value
46690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14877a6a868f530bfcb51a9d84a8cb0eb8372a26 OP_EQUAL
address
M9mi3TRK699Q7PgKWH6xP3A8UsSpryXWnz
transaction
29f17d86f738fd720fa68d7e0403136d695d122cc47c4ef8c8698abce6230858
spent
true